betatoteutuksia
Betatoteutuksia refers to beta implementations or beta versions of software or products. In the context of software development, a beta version is a pre-release version of a product that is made available to a wider audience for testing before its final release. This phase is crucial for identifying and fixing bugs, gathering user feedback on usability and features, and ensuring the product meets the expectations of its target users. Companies often invite specific groups of users or make beta versions publicly available to collect a diverse range of feedback. This testing period allows for real-world usage scenarios to be explored, which might not have been anticipated during internal development. The feedback received during beta testing directly influences the final product's refinement and stability. Similarly, "betatoteutuksia" can also apply to the early stages of implementing new processes or strategies within an organization, where a limited rollout or trial period is used to assess effectiveness and make necessary adjustments before a full-scale deployment. It represents a stage of development that is beyond alpha testing (internal testing) but not yet the final, stable release.
